District Overview
Located at 10850 East Woodmen Road in Peyton, Colorado, El Paso County Colorado School District 49 serves as an active, comprehensive public school district embedded within the greater Colorado Springs metropolitan area. Grounded in the 2024–2025 NCES dataset, this fully operational regular district manages 31 schools and delivers a continuous academic curriculum spanning from pre-kindergarten through 12th grade. Operating in a vibrant large-city setting, District 49 accommodates a diverse student body of 25,689 enrolled learners, offering families and students robust educational pathways across elementary, middle, and secondary grade levels.

To support its large student population, District 49 maintains an extensive professional network with a total workforce of approximately 6,368 full-time equivalent staff members. This includes roughly 2,762 full-time equivalent teachers, 603 instructional aides, and over 3,000 support personnel, creating a well-resourced environment designed to meet varied instructional and operational needs.
